# Break-Glass: Static-Analysis Baseline (Corvidale)

For the weekly eng sync: the Corvidale linter baseline file is now locked behind the release vault to stop ad-hoc suppressions. Routine edits go through normal review. If CI is fully blocked and no approver is reachable, break-glass access is permitted. Unsealing the vault requires the recovery passphrase, noted directly below this section.

recovery phrase for fawif-tajeg: norael-aldmir-casir-brivan-ulaion

# Env file — Cartwheel dispatch, driver-assignment heuristic
# Scope: staging only. Do not promote to prod.
# The heuristic weights (proximity, shift balance, refusal rate) are tuned
# for the Velmont pilot region and will misbehave elsewhere.
# Review notes: heuristic service runs unprivileged; it reads weights
# read-only from the tuning store and writes nothing back.
# Only one sensitive value exists in this file: the tuning-store access
# credential, consumed at boot and never logged.
# That credential is set on the following line.

secret setting of faduf-bahop: LEDGER_TOKEN8=c3b363be

Alert: FareForge rule evaluation latency exceeded threshold. The shipping-fee rules engine recomputes surcharges whenever carrier tables change, and slow evaluations can delay checkout quotes on Cartwheel storefronts. New team members should check the rule cache hit rate before escalating, since most incidents resolve after a cache warm. Full triage steps live on the internal page below.

runbook for badug-kadup: https://confluence.zemvarlabs.internal/projects/browse/display/projects/bd1b

# Runbook: Hunting leaked file descriptors in Quillgate

When the `fd_open` gauge climbs steadily between deploys, suspect a leak rather than load. First confirm on a single pod: exec in and count entries under `/proc/1/fd`, noting how many are sockets in CLOSE_WAIT versus regular files. Capture two snapshots ten minutes apart before restarting anything — we need the delta for the postmortem. Reproduce locally with the Marbury load harness, which requires the service running with the following configuration values.

settings of yagep-bajog:
[istdor]
port = 4000
region = south-2
host = istdor.qorvelcorp.internal
timeout_ms = 5000
retries = 5